Herb Trough

Posted May 19 2009 4:35pm

A herb trough is attractive and productive, producing an abundance of herbs for the kitchen.

herb-trough

herb-trough

A herb trough:

* can be any size, to suit the space available.
* can be made from any container, as long as it has drainage holes.
* must be watered regularly in the summer.

The herb trough in the picture contains:

* chives
* thyme
* marjoram
* borage
* mint

Each herb has an abundance of flowers, which attract the bees. All these
herbs have over-wintered well in the herb trough.
